Dreamtime is a visionary work of myth, memory, and spiritual excavation by one of Ireland's most original thinkers. In this profound journey of the soul, John Moriarty draws from global mythologies, literature, and personal experience to uncover the shared stories that shape human consciousness and the natural world. Woven through with richly poetic language and startling philosophical insight, Moriarty reconnects Western culture with the sacred imagination it has long forsaken. From Aboriginal Dreamtime to Homer, from Celtic folklore to Christian mysticism, Moriarty travels widely and fearlessly through the symbolic landscapes that have animated human life for millennia.


The task of the poet-philosopher, Moriarty suggests, is to enlarge our capacity for symbolic understanding, while keeping the path to Connla's Well open and inviting us to inhabit a shared Dreamtime Dreamtime is not just a book—it is a re-enchantment, a call to awaken the mythic soul and to live in harmony with the Earth and its ancient wisdoms. A Book of Revelations grounded in sense as in spirit, Dreamtime refuses known categories, invites fresh modes of understanding and contains multitudes, introducing the reader to 'the splendour and terror and danger and wonder of a world everywhere and in everything eruptively Divine'. This is a powerful work of literature by a masterspirit of modern times.


About the Author


JOHN MORIARTY, writer and philosopher, was born in Kerry in 1938 and educated at Listowel and University College Dublin. He taught English literature at Manitoba University in Canada for six years, returning to Ireland in 1971. He is author of three volumes of Turtle Was Gone a Long Time: Crossing the Kedron (1996), Horsehead Nebula Neighing (1997) and Anaconda Canoe (1998). In 1997 he hosted a major six-part RTE television series, ‘The Blackbird & the Bell‘. He lived down from the Horse’s Glen at the foot of Mangerton Mountain in north Kerry, and died June 1st 2007.
